The Tropical Forestry Initiative is an organization formed by eight persons of diverse professional backgrounds who share a concern about the loss of tropical forests and have joined to demonstrate that rainforests can be restored by planting and managing indigenous tree species. Our 350 acre farm, named Los Arboles, is ideal for tree nursery research and production, plantations of indigneous tree species, and management of primary and secondary forests.
